Цель изобретени  - улучшить варочные свойства, снизить температуру выработки.The purpose of the invention is to improve the cooking properties, reduce the temperature of production.

Достигаетс  это тем, что стекло в качестве RO содержит СаО.This is achieved by the fact that glass as an RO contains CaO.

Примерный состав стекла, вес.%: SiOa57,5The approximate composition of the glass, wt.%: SiOa57,5

МгОз13,0MgOz13.0

СаО17,2CaO17.2

МпО0,7MpO0,7

ТЮг0,1Tug 0,1

FesOs+FeO0,5FesOs + FeO0,5

MgO 3,0MgO 3.0

Na20+K208,0Na20 + K208.0

Свойства стекла.Properties of glass.

Температура начала выработки, соответствующа  10 пауз, °С 1280The temperature of the beginning of production, corresponding to 10 pauses, ° C 1280

Температура, соответствуюш,а  исчезновению кристаллов, °С 1180Temperature, corresponding to, and disappearance of crystals, ° С 1180

Температура конца выработки, соответствующа  10 пауз, °С 970The temperature of the end of production, corresponding to 10 pauses, ° C 970

Температурный интервал выработки , °С320Temperature range of production, ° C320

Химическа  стойкость (% весовых потерь)Chemical resistance (% weight loss)

в воде0,065in water0.065

в кислоте0,07in acid0.07
